|
本帖最后由 wang2011214 于 2013-3-27 22:56 編輯 - G# f, n8 J6 q; A
9 H- g9 y2 w$ s2 L6 v
#2801=#2801+#2101(#2801一號(hào)刀補(bǔ)#2101一號(hào)刀磨耗,磨耗加入刀補(bǔ))
# Z: w* k" `& K: t#2101=0(z方向磨耗清零)( G/ Q3 u1 {# v$ j
#5202=0(外部工件偏移z方向清空)
) |9 e) J: f) T' E; g" H#5222=0(g54z方向清空)8 D/ S0 S, H# _
#2601=0(工件偏移z方向清空)8 i% R5 X2 n5 v2 d' {/ K
#5202=#26-#5022+#2801
0 B7 [' A S3 ^6 E8 d2 ?(寫入外部偏移z方向數(shù)據(jù),指定的z值減去機(jī)械坐標(biāo)值加上一號(hào)刀刀補(bǔ))' }' Q# C4 {- W! r7 ^
m99# M' E) ?& `6 X& l1 c( L3 U
g100調(diào)用,比如用一號(hào)刀平了面是z0,在mdi下輸入g100 z0執(zhí)行即可…一次性對(duì)好刀塔上所有刀的z方向,前提是你要用一號(hào)刀作為基準(zhǔn)刀且所有刀具一個(gè)基準(zhǔn)!1 G S8 h T- f3 K
這個(gè)程序只是幫大家把平移工件坐標(biāo)系簡(jiǎn)化了,還有很多報(bào)警,對(duì)比刀補(bǔ)沒有寫進(jìn)來,可能每個(gè)機(jī)床計(jì)算刀補(bǔ)方向不同所以要根據(jù)實(shí)際機(jī)床情況修改!還望高手們指點(diǎn)指點(diǎn)…
- S; v, T# W/ u4 o& [' B程序已經(jīng)在機(jī)床上測(cè)試使用了一段時(shí)間,有個(gè)問題還請(qǐng)大俠指點(diǎn)下…每次短料換長(zhǎng)料的時(shí)候執(zhí)行平移后總會(huì)有幾十絲的誤差,執(zhí)行完后用#5042讀取當(dāng)前坐標(biāo)讀取的是我的平移值,但絕對(duì)坐標(biāo)顯示的卻比讀取值小三十幾絲只能再把誤差補(bǔ)進(jìn)去才能ok!4 a7 W' e" ] _3 t; j( I* t
|
|